
A marketing ROI calculator is a powerful tool. It’s what takes your marketing spend and turns it into hard revenue figures, giving you the confidence to justify every dollar you invest. It stops the guesswork and starts building a data-backed strategy, showing you exactly which campaigns are making you money and which are just draining the budget.

Let's be honest, spending money on marketing without knowing the return feels like a bit of a gamble. This is precisely where a marketing ROI calculator becomes your most valuable strategic partner. It’s not just about crunching numbers; it’s about arming yourself with the financial intelligence to steer your business towards real, sustainable growth.
When you consistently measure your return on investment, you transform marketing from a perceived cost centre into a proven revenue driver. This shift in perspective is absolutely essential when you're trying to justify budgets to stakeholders or deciding where to put your next dollar. Instead of saying, "We got 5,000 clicks," you can confidently state, "We invested $20,000 and generated $80,000 in new business—that's a 300% ROI."
Relying on gut feelings to guide your marketing spend is a risky way to do business. A marketing ROI calculator replaces that uncertainty with hard data, pulling back the curtain on the true performance of each channel and campaign. This clarity allows for smarter decisions that fuel actual growth.
This is especially true in professional services. For example, we've seen targeted Google Ads campaigns in the Australian legal sector achieve a staggering 400% ROI, turning a $5,000 spend into $25,000 in revenue. Channel-specific returns can vary wildly; SEO often averages a 520% ROI over three years, while social media can trail at around 210%. Having this kind of data is what prompts smart businesses to reallocate their budgets for the best possible returns.
By measuring ROI, you turn every campaign into a learning opportunity. It creates a closed-loop feedback system that improves targeting, messaging, and funnel efficiency across the board, ensuring you're always optimising.
Before you start plugging numbers into a calculator, it's crucial to get a real handle on the marketing ROI meaning for your specific business. It’s not a one-size-fits-all metric. What constitutes a ‘good’ ROI really depends on several factors:
Understanding these nuances is the first step. A marketing ROI calculator gives you the framework to measure performance against your unique goals, helping you stop guessing and start making truly profitable decisions for your business.

On the surface, the marketing ROI formula looks simple enough: (Sales Growth - Marketing Cost) / Marketing Cost. But don't be fooled by the primary school maths. The real magic isn't in the equation itself, but in the quality of the numbers you feed into it.
Getting this right is what separates a vague guess from a genuine business insight. This simple calculation is the bedrock of any effective marketing ROI calculator, so understanding the fundamentals of Measuring Return on Marketing Investment is non-negotiable.
The formula gives you a clear percentage. Let's say you spent $10,000 on a campaign that pulled in $50,000 in new sales growth. Your ROI would be a very healthy 400%. This tells you instantly that for every dollar you put in, you got four dollars back.
"Sales Growth" is all about the revenue that your marketing efforts directly created. Honestly, this is the trickiest part of the whole equation because it relies on accurate attribution—the art of connecting a specific sale back to a specific marketing touchpoint. Just looking at your total revenue jump for the month won’t cut it.
You have to isolate the revenue that simply wouldn't exist without your campaign. This might mean using unique discount codes for a social media promo, tracking form fills from a dedicated landing page, or using UTM parameters to follow a customer's path from an email click right through to checkout. For businesses with longer sales cycles, it’s about tracing a lead from that first touchpoint—like a content download or webinar signup—all the way to a closed deal in your CRM.
This is where so many businesses get it wrong. "Marketing Cost" is so much more than just what you paid for the ads. A classic mistake is to only count the most obvious expenses, which gives you an inflated and misleading ROI. For a true picture of your investment, you need to tally up every single cost tied to running the campaign.
A complete list of marketing costs should include:
Pro Tip: Set up a master spreadsheet to track all these "hidden" costs for every campaign. It might feel like a bit of extra work at first, but it’s the only way to ensure your marketing ROI calculator gives you a realistic and defensible number you can stand behind.
Let’s picture an Australian e-commerce store launching a new skincare line. They spend $5,000 on Meta ads, $1,500 on an influencer collaboration, and $500 on graphic design. That’s a total marketing cost of $7,000. The campaign directly generates $28,000 in sales through a tracked link.
Their ROI calculation would be: ($28,000 - $7,000) / $7,000 = 3.0, or a 300% return. This clear result not only validates their spend but also gives them a solid benchmark for the next launch. Remember, getting your inputs right is a crucial step to truly understanding the customer journey. For a deeper dive into tracking actions, have a look at our guide on how to calculate conversion rate.
An ROI calculator is a powerful tool, but it has one massive weakness: it can't tell when you're feeding it bad numbers. It just crunches what you give it. That old saying, "garbage in, garbage out," has never been more true. A fancy calculator won't just fail to save you from a shaky data foundation; it will actually magnify your mistakes.
That’s why getting your data house in order isn't just a warm-up exercise. It’s the whole game. Before you can calculate a single thing, you need to know exactly what to track and, just as importantly, where to find it. This goes way beyond just looking at total sales figures; it’s about digging into the numbers that truly show you what's profitable and what isn't.
To get a real, honest return on investment figure, your data needs to tell the complete story. Think of it as following a customer from their very first click on an ad all the way through to a signed contract and their ongoing value to your business. This means pulling information from a few different, but connected, parts of your company.
The main inputs you'll be working with are:
The real trick is to see these as interconnected parts of a machine. A high cost-per-lead might look bad on its own, but if those leads have a fantastic conversion rate and a high LTV, that initial investment suddenly looks like a bargain.
Once you know which metrics you need, the next job is to make sure your tech stack is actually capturing this data cleanly and consistently. You need a smooth flow of information from your marketing platforms right through to your sales systems.
For most businesses, this rests on three core pillars:
Website & Analytics Platform (e.g., Google Analytics 4): This is your window into user behaviour. You need to set up conversion goals for the actions that matter, like someone filling out a contact form, downloading a guide, or making a purchase. GA4 is perfect for figuring out which channels are bringing in the traffic that counts.
Ad Platforms (e.g., Google Ads, Meta Ads): These are your frontline for tracking direct campaign results. Double-check that your conversion tracking pixels are installed correctly on your site. This is how you'll measure actions and attribute them back to specific ads, giving you your ad spend and direct conversion numbers.
Customer Relationship Management (CRM) System: Your CRM is the heart of your sales operation. It’s where your team manages leads, tracks deals, and logs revenue. When you integrate your CRM with your marketing platforms, you create a "closed-loop" system that lets you see exactly which marketing sources are bringing in your most valuable customers.
Data integrity is everything when it comes to making smart strategic decisions. An ROI calculation based on messy or incomplete data is worse than no calculation at all—it can trick you into cutting your best campaigns or pouring more money into ones that are failing.
Let's picture a real-world scenario. A B2B service provider in Australia runs a LinkedIn campaign for their consulting services. They track a prospect who clicks an ad, lands on their website, and downloads a whitepaper (tracked as a goal in GA4). That lead flows into their CRM. Weeks later, after being nurtured by the sales team, they sign a $15,000 contract. Because the systems are connected, the business can trace that revenue all the way back to the initial LinkedIn campaign, giving them a precise figure to plug into their ROI calculator.
It also helps to know what "good" looks like. According to data from a tool built for Australian businesses, the average B2B conversion rate here is around 2.6%. For a medium-sized company, a typical lead-to-customer rate of 15-20% is a solid baseline for ROI modelling, helping you see how you measure up. You can play around with these numbers and see more benchmarks using this handy ROI tool from Digital Freak.
When you gather clean data and compare it against industry standards, you're no longer guessing. And for a complete rundown of what to track, have a look at our guide on digital marketing performance metrics to make sure nothing important slips through the cracks.
Formulas on a page are one thing, but seeing your marketing ROI come to life with real numbers is where the magic really happens. Let's step away from the abstract and get our hands dirty with a couple of practical scenarios.
This is all about connecting the dots between what you spend and what you earn. It’s about building that bridge so you can confidently decide where your next marketing dollar should go.
Let's imagine a local plumbing business in Adelaide. Their goal is simple: get more emergency call-out jobs. They decide to run a focused Google Ads campaign, targeting keywords like "emergency plumber Adelaide" and "24/7 plumber near me."
Here’s how their month played out:
Time to plug those numbers into our formula: (Sales Growth - Marketing Cost) / Marketing Cost.
The calculation looks like this: ($9,000 - $2,500) / $2,500 = 2.6
That works out to a 260% ROI. For every single dollar they invested, they made $2.60 back in revenue. A return like that gives them the confidence to not just continue but maybe even ramp up their Google Ads budget.
Now for a different business—a national e-commerce store selling sustainable activewear. They’re launching a new collection and decide to promote it through an Instagram influencer campaign.
Here's what the numbers look like for them:
Using the same ROI formula:
Calculation: ($30,000 - $8,000) / $8,000 = 2.75
The campaign delivered an impressive 275% ROI. This doesn't just validate their influencer strategy; it also shows them which specific influencers drove the most sales, giving them powerful insights for future collaborations.
The examples above are clean and simple, assuming a straight line from an ad to a sale. But in the real world, the customer journey is rarely that neat. A customer might see your Instagram post, Google your brand a week later, and finally buy after getting a promo email.
So, who gets the credit? This is where attribution models come into play.
An attribution model is just the set of rules you use to assign value to the different touchpoints a customer interacts with on their way to making a purchase. The model you pick can completely change the ROI you calculate for each channel.
To get this right, you need to pull data from a few key places.

Your GA4 shows you what people do on your site, your CRM holds customer data, and your ad platforms report on campaign performance. They all need to talk to each other to give you the full story.
Let's look at how different models would divvy up the credit for a single $1,000 sale that involved Google Ads, SEO, and Email Marketing.
This table shows just how dramatically your chosen attribution model can shift the perceived value of each marketing channel.
| Attribution Model | Google Ads Credit | SEO Credit | Email Marketing Credit | Calculated ROI Impact |
|---|---|---|---|---|
| First-Touch | $1,000 (100%) | $0 | $0 | Heavily favours top-of-funnel channels that introduce the brand. |
| Last-Touch | $0 | $0 | $1,000 (100%) | Gives all credit to the final touchpoint that closes the deal. |
| Linear | $333 (33%) | $333 (33%) | $333 (33%) | Spreads credit evenly, giving a more balanced view of teamwork. |
| U-Shaped | $400 (40%) | $200 (20%) | $400 (40%) | Values the first and last interactions most, with some for the middle. |
As you can see, your choice is far more than a technicality—it’s a major strategic decision.
A last-touch model might trick you into thinking your SEO efforts are worthless and lead you to cut the budget, even if SEO is how most of your new customers discover you in the first place.
Choosing the right model really depends on your business. For products with a short sales cycle, a last-touch model might be good enough. But for longer, more considered purchases, like in B2B, a linear or U-shaped model often paints a much more realistic picture. The goal is to build a measurement system that truly reflects how your customers find and buy from you.
Figuring out your return on investment is a crucial first step. But the real growth happens when you start improving that number. Getting a figure from your marketing ROI calculator is just the beginning; optimising that result is where your strategy truly comes to life.
Too many businesses stumble into the same old traps when they try to measure performance. They get bogged down by common pitfalls that either spit out a misleading ROI figure or, worse, stop them from improving it at all. Understanding these mistakes is the key to unlocking much better returns.
One of the most common errors we see is an almost frantic focus on immediate results. A campaign that doesn’t deliver a positive ROI in its first week gets labelled a failure and is shut down. This kind of short-term thinking completely misses the bigger picture.
It ignores the value of building a brand and the simple fact that most customer journeys aren't a straight line from A to B. A potential customer might need to see your message multiple times over weeks, or even months, before they're ready to make a purchase. By pulling the plug on campaigns too early, you could be abandoning strategies that were on track to deliver exceptional long-term value.
Instead, you need to be thinking about the full sales cycle and the Customer Lifetime Value (LTV). A customer who makes one small initial purchase could become a loyal advocate who spends thousands with you over several years. Factoring LTV into your ROI calculation gives you a far more accurate and strategic view of a campaign's real worth.
Another major roadblock is just plain messy data. If your tracking isn't set up properly from the get-go, the numbers you're feeding into your marketing ROI calculator will be fundamentally flawed. This often happens when businesses only count direct ad spend and forget about all the other significant expenses.
To get a true picture, your marketing investment needs to include everything:
Forgetting these costs will artificially inflate your ROI, tricking you into believing a campaign is more successful than it really is. This can lead to some pretty poor budget decisions down the line. It's also vital to track your Return on Ad Spend (ROAS) separately. For a deeper look at this metric, you can explore our guide on what ROAS in marketing really means for your business.
The most dangerous outcome of sloppy tracking isn't just a bad number; it's the false confidence it creates. You end up doubling down on what you think is working, while your real profit drivers might be completely overlooked.
Once you’ve sidestepped these common mistakes, you can get proactive with optimisation. These are the actionable tactics that directly influence the variables in your ROI formula, turning small improvements into significant financial gains. Tiny tweaks can have an outsized impact on your bottom line.
One of the most powerful levers you can pull is A/B testing. Don't just launch one version of an ad or landing page and cross your fingers. Continuously test different headlines, images, calls-to-action, and even colour schemes. A change that seems minor on the surface can lead to a dramatic lift in your click-through or conversion rates.
Improving your landing page conversion rate is another absolute game-changer. You could have the best ads in the world, but if the page they lead to is slow, confusing, or unconvincing, you're just burning cash. Make sure your landing page is laser-focused on a single action, loads quickly, and reinforces the promise you made in your ad. Even a 0.5% boost in your conversion rate can have a massive impact on your final ROI.
Finally, relentlessly refine your audience targeting. As your campaigns run, you'll gather more data about who is actually converting. Use this information to narrow your focus onto the demographics, interests, and behaviours that deliver the most valuable customers. The more precise your targeting, the less money you waste on clicks that were never going to convert anyway.
Implementing marketing automation is another powerful way to boost efficiency and, in turn, ROI. For example, calculators focused on marketing automation ROI reveal a huge opportunity for Australian businesses, with platforms like ActiveCampaign delivering a 400-600% average ROI over two years. By automating tasks a marketing manager would otherwise do by hand, a business can save thousands in labour costs, directly boosting their overall return. You can learn more about how to calculate marketing automation ROI and see the potential savings for yourself.
Once you start digging into marketing ROI, moving from theory to real-world application, it’s only natural for new questions to surface. It always happens. You get the basics down, then the "what ifs" and "how abouts" start popping up.
This is your quick-reference guide for those exact moments. We’ll cut through the jargon and give you straight answers to the most common questions we hear from businesses trying to get a real handle on their numbers.
Everyone wants that magic number, but the truth is, there isn't one. While you'll often hear a 5:1 ratio (a 400% ROI) thrown around as a solid benchmark, what's actually 'good' is completely tied to your business model and margins.
A high-volume, low-margin e-commerce store, for instance, might be doing backflips over a 3:1 ROI. Their whole game is built on quantity. But a high-touch B2B service with a long sales cycle and much higher operating costs? They might need to see a 10:1 ROI before a campaign is considered genuinely profitable.
The most powerful approach is to stop looking over your shoulder and start benchmarking against yourself. Figure out your current ROI, know your profit margins inside and out, and then set a clear goal for steady improvement. 'Good' is whatever drives profitable growth for your business.
The right rhythm for checking your ROI depends entirely on the speed of the marketing channels you're using. It’s definitely not a one-size-fits-all schedule.
A good rule of thumb is to try and align your calculation frequency with your typical sales cycle.
Yes, you absolutely can, but you have to think about it a little differently. Brand awareness campaigns don't always have a straight line to an immediate sale, so you can't just plug direct revenue into the standard formula. Instead, you need to use proxy metrics.
Think of it as measuring the return based on the value of other important outcomes, like:
By assigning a monetary value to these outcomes, you can calculate a non-direct ROI. It’s less precise than a calculation tied directly to sales, sure, but it’s crucial for justifying those top-of-funnel investments that build your brand's long-term health and make every future customer cheaper to acquire.
Ready to stop guessing and start getting real, measurable results from your marketing? The team at Virtual Ad Agency specialises in full-funnel marketing strategies that deliver clear, provable ROI. We help Australian businesses like yours optimise every dollar spent. Book a no-obligation strategy session with us today.